Artem Babaian is a scholar working on Molecular Biology, Plant Science and Ecology. According to data from OpenAlex, Artem Babaian has authored 23 papers receiving a total of 955 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Molecular Biology, 10 papers in Plant Science and 4 papers in Ecology. Recurrent topics in Artem Babaian's work include Genomics and Phylogenetic Studies (5 papers), RNA modifications and cancer (5 papers) and Chromosomal and Genetic Variations (5 papers). Artem Babaian is often cited by papers focused on Genomics and Phylogenetic Studies (5 papers), RNA modifications and cancer (5 papers) and Chromosomal and Genetic Variations (5 papers). Artem Babaian collaborates with scholars based in Canada, United States and France. Artem Babaian's co-authors include Dixie L. Mager, R. C. Edgar, Marcos de la Peña, Liane Gagnier, Mohammad M. Karimi, Rayan Chikhi, Dmitry Meleshko, Basem Al-Shayeb, Tomer Altman and Pierre Barbera and has published in prestigious journals such as Nature, Cell and Proceedings of the National Academy of Sciences.
